The Facts: Hawkins said in a video posted to Uninterrupted's Twitter account that he is signing with the Patriots. Hawkins visited with the team last week.

Hawkins caught 33 passes for 324 yards and three touchdowns while playing in all 16 games for the Browns last year. That was his third season in Cleveland, a run that started with career highs of 63 catches and 824 yards in 2014. He’ll join a Patriots receiving corps that includes Brandin Cooks, Julian Edelman, Danny Amendola, Malcolm Mitchell and Chris Hogan, so there’s going to be some work for Hawkins to do to claim a roster spot come the end of the preseason.
